对于技术爱好者和开发者而言,一个稳定、高速且安全的网络环境是进行跨境代码协作、访问开源平台(如GitHub、Docker Hub)的刚需。尤其是在使用Ubuntu 18.04 LTS这类经典服务器系统时,网络限制常常成为效率瓶颈。本文将详细介绍如何在Ubuntu 18.04 LTS服务器上部署一款轻量、开源的解决方案——QuickQ,旨在为技术社区提供一个高效的网络加速实践指南。
引言:为何选择QuickQ进行服务器端部署?
QuickQ,常被称为QuickQ VPN或QuickQ加速器,是一款专注于为开发者提供低延迟、高带宽跨境网络服务的工具。与常规的桌面客户端不同,在Ubuntu服务器上直接部署QuickQ服务,可以实现系统级的透明代理,让所有运行在该服务器上的服务(如Git、Docker、APT包管理器)都能无障碍访问国际开源资源。无论是从QuickQ官网获取核心组件,还是进行后续配置,这一过程本身也是对Linux网络管理的深度实践。
核心内容一:环境准备与QuickQ组件获取
首先,确保你的Ubuntu 18.04 LTS系统已更新。随后,我们需要获取QuickQ的Linux版本。虽然QuickQ官网主要推广其图形化客户端,如QuickQ电脑版、QuickQ Mac、QuickQ安卓和QuickQ iOS,但其核心代理服务通常提供命令行版本。技术爱好者可以通过QuickQ下载页面或开发者渠道找到适用于Linux的命令行工具(有时以“quickq”或“QuickQ CLI”命名)。请务必从官方或可信源获取,确保安全。
核心内容二:在Ubuntu 18.04 LTS上安装与配置QuickQ服务
安装过程依赖于具体的软件包格式。假设我们下载的是QuickQ的.deb包或二进制文件。通过终端进行安装和基础配置是关键步骤。配置QuickQ VPN时,你需要输入从QuickQ官网获取的账户信息或节点配置。与使用QuickQ电脑版或QuickQ Mac的图形界面不同,服务器版配置通常通过编辑配置文件(如JSON或YAML)完成,这要求用户对网络参数有基本理解。配置的目标是让QuickQ加速器服务在系统后台稳定运行,并设置合理的路由规则。
核心内容三:集成系统服务与实战应用场景
为了让QuickQ在服务器启动时自动运行,我们需要将其配置为Systemd服务。这是与在个人设备上使用QuickQ安卓或QuickQ iOS应用截然不同的体验,体现了服务器管理的专业性。配置成功后,便可解锁多种实用场景:
- 场景1:无障碍Git操作:之前克隆GitHub仓库缓慢甚至失败,在部署QuickQ加速器后,git clone和git push速度得到显著提升,极大改善了跨境代码协作体验。
- 场景2:高效Docker镜像拉取:在构建容器时,Docker Hub镜像拉取速度直接影响部署效率。通过QuickQ VPN建立的通道,可以加速这一过程,节约大量时间。
- 场景3:稳定的APT更新与软件安装:为Ubuntu系统本身配置通过QuickQ进行APT流量代理,可以快速完成系统更新和软件安装,避免因网络问题导致的安装中断。
这些场景验证了在服务器端部署quickq服务的实用价值,其效果远优于在每台个人设备(如使用quickq电脑版或quickq Mac)上单独配置。
核心内容四:安全考量与性能优化
部署任何网络服务,安全都是首要考量。确保你使用的quickq官网提供的正版软件,并定期更新。在配置防火墙规则时,仅允许必要的端口通过。性能优化方面,可以根据服务器所处地理位置,在quickq VPN的多个节点中选择延迟最低的进行连接。监控QuickQ服务的资源占用(CPU/内存),确保其轻量特性不会影响服务器上其他核心应用。这与在移动端使用quickq安卓或quickq iOS时关注电量消耗的逻辑类似,但服务器端更注重长期稳定性。
总结
在Ubuntu 18.04 LTS服务器上部署QuickQ,是一项极具价值的技术实践。它超越了仅仅在个人电脑上使用QuickQ电脑版或在手机上使用QuickQ安卓/iOS应用的范畴,实现了基础设施层的网络优化。通过从QuickQ下载服务器专用组件,进行严谨配置,技术爱好者可以为自己的开发环境或项目服务器构建一个高速、可靠的跨境网络通道。无论是为了更流畅地访问QuickQ官网更新服务,还是为了提升团队的开源协作效率,这套轻量开源的部署方案都值得深入尝试和应用。记住,无论平台是Linux、Mac还是Windows,选择正确的QuickQ下载渠道并合理配置,是享受QuickQ加速器优质服务的前提。